About G. Perdikakis

G. Perdikakis is a scholar working on Nuclear and High Energy Physics, Radiation, Aerospace Engineering, Atomic and Molecular Physics, and Optics and Astronomy and Astrophysics, having authored 45 papers that have together received 674 indexed citations. Recurring topics across this work include Nuclear physics research studies (36 papers), Nuclear Physics and Applications (24 papers), Nuclear reactor physics and engineering (15 papers), Astronomical and nuclear sciences (14 papers), Atomic and Molecular Physics (9 papers), X-ray Spectroscopy and Fluorescence Analysis (7 papers), Advanced Chemical Physics Studies (4 papers) and Particle accelerators and beam dynamics (4 papers). The work is most often cited by research in Nuclear and High Energy Physics (603 citations), Radiation (275 citations), Aerospace Engineering (193 citations), Atomic and Molecular Physics, and Optics (213 citations) and Astronomy and Astrophysics (49 citations). G. Perdikakis has collaborated with scholars based in United States, Greece and France. Frequent co-authors include A. Lagoyannis, M. Kokkoris, N. Patronis, A. Spyrou, C. Papachristodoulou, A. Pakou, N. Alamanos, D. Pierroutsakou, A. Gillibert and E. C. Pollacco. Their work appears in journals such as Physical review. C,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ment, Nuclear Instruments and Methods in Physics Research Section B Beam Interactions with Materials and Atoms, Journal of Physics G Nuclear and Particle Physics and Nuclear Physics A.
